Transaction 05d3f976955a6c4649ec2d79310df4aceb2cee86c7db826b76373edc3704b0aa
1 Input
1 Outputs
- 05d3f976955a6c4649ec2d79310df4aceb2cee86c7db826b76373edc3704b0aa:0
value 199919000
address 3LnD1DeRrDhPPQgFR1H1XQkWfKw5Ze59bb